Differences in HIV natural history among African and non-African seroconverters in Europe and seroconverters in sub-Saharan Africa.

<h4>Introduction</h4>It is unknown whether HIV treatment guidelines, based on resource-rich country cohorts, are applicable to African populations.<h4>Methods</h4>We estimated CD4 cell loss in ART-naïve, AIDS-free individuals using mixed models allowing for random intercept a...
